How To Fix CM_EHHSS_INC_COMMON212 - Fill at least one of the following fields: &1, &2, or &3


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CM_EHHSS_INC_COMMON - Incident Common Messages

  • Message number: 212

  • Message text: Fill at least one of the following fields: &1, &2, or &3

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CM_EHHSS_INC_COMMON212 - Fill at least one of the following fields: &1, &2, or &3 ?

    The SAP error message CM_EHHSS_INC_COMMON212 indicates that a user is trying to perform an action in the SAP system that requires at least one of the specified fields to be filled in, but none of them have been populated. This error typically occurs in the context of the Environment, Health, and Safety (EHS) module, particularly when dealing with incident management or reporting.

    Cause:

    The error arises when a user attempts to save or submit a form or transaction without filling in any of the required fields specified in the error message (represented as &1, &2, and &3). These fields are usually critical for the process being executed, such as reporting an incident, and the system requires at least one of them to be filled to proceed.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you should:

    1. Identify the Fields: Check the error message to see which fields are indicated as &1, &2, and &3. These will typically be specific fields in the form or transaction you are working with.

    2. Fill in Required Fields: Ensure that at least one of the specified fields is filled in with valid data. This could involve entering information such as:

      • Incident type
      • Date of the incident
      • Location of the incident
      • Any other relevant details that are required for the process.
    3. Validation: After filling in the required fields, validate the data to ensure it meets any necessary criteria (e.g., format, length).

    4. Retry the Action: Once you have filled in the required fields, attempt to save or submit the form again.

    Related Information:

    • Field Definitions: If you are unsure about what information to enter in the specified fields, refer to the documentation or help resources related to the EHS module in your SAP system.
    • User Permissions: Ensure that you have the necessary permissions to fill in the fields and perform the action you are attempting.
    • System Configuration: If the error persists even after filling in the fields, it may be worth checking with your SAP administrator to ensure that the system configuration is correct and that there are no additional validation rules that might be causing the issue.
